Epoxy putty can be used to fix leaks anywhere in a plumbing line It is a quick and simple way to repair pipes, fixtures, and fittings at a reasonably low cost Epoxy putty is unique because of the small amount of time that it takes to set and become effective

After cleaning the pipe, thoroughly dry the area around the leak and use a piece of sandpaper to score or roughen the area around the leak Take enough of each of the two components to cover the leak and knead the pieces together. Use epoxy putty or pipe putty as a temporary fix to a leaky pipe Pipe putty is designed to harden at room temperature and seal the hole or crack

Turn off the water supply line in the house

Drain the damaged line and ensure that the area to be patched is clean and dry so that the epoxy putty will properly adhere to the pipe.
